Transaction a1c57848086b6b90f9639a520ff58d2bfe8419a3b6393207ee87d5c24f517178
2 Input
2 Outputs
- a1c57848086b6b90f9639a520ff58d2bfe8419a3b6393207ee87d5c24f517178:0
- a1c57848086b6b90f9639a520ff58d2bfe8419a3b6393207ee87d5c24f517178:1
value 5500067043
address 1N66A1Rpigv8q9uP15Zhg21kvDTmz4QfSr
value 500000000
address 3QWJYC5jzyFwKHJCAN82Azsc7CoiEoAr8W